JOB PURPOSE:
As part of our growth strategy, we are seeking a highly skilled IT Professional with experience in Artificial Intelligence technologies to join our dynamic team. The role is part of the Enterprise Architecture team.
The newly created Ice Cream Technology function will drive the technology set-up, standalone design and implementation of all required technology capabilities to enable Unilever’s Ice Cream business to become a fully functioning standalone company, separate from Unilever.
This role is responsible for the creation of a virtual AI Centre of Excellence that will drive the creation of an Enterprise-wide Autonomous AI platform. The platform will connect to all Ice Cream technology solutions providing an AI capability that can provide autonomous business processes and has the capacity to identify and resolve issues without the requirements for human intervention. The platform is expected to enable high levels of automation and intelligent decision-making across all facets of the Ice Cream organisation. Due to the cross-functional nature of this platform, the role requires a collaborative leadership approach.
